To provide a method for treating fine powder capable of separating a calcium component and a lead component from the fine powder containing the calcium component and the lead component by a simple operation to recover the lead component with a high rate.
The method for treating fine powder comprises: the step (A) of mixing fine powder containing the calcium component and the lead component, water and a sulfurizing agent to obtain slurry containing a solid content of sulfurized lead; the step (B) of subjecting the slurry to solid-liquid separation to obtain a solid content containing sulfurized lead and a liquid content containing a water-soluble sulfur component originated from the sulfurizing agent; the step (C) of adding water and sulfuric acid to the solid content obtained by the step (B) and mixing to obtain a slurry containing a solid content of sulfurized lead and calcium sulfate; the step (D) of adding a collecting agent to the slurry obtained in the step (C) to hydrophobize the sulfurized lead in the slurry; and the step (E) of subjecting the slurry obtained in the step (D) to flotation treatment to obtain a floating mineral containing the sulfurized lead and a precipitated mineral containing calcium sulfate.
